Year Six Book Group: The verdict on 'Millions' by Frank Cottrell Boyce

Millions is about two brothers who acquire bags stuffed with more money than they can handle. Damian thinks it is a gift from God. Anthony knows different. Euro day is fast approaching and the more cash they spend, the heavier the burden. When people get wind of the money, fun turns to danger. A story that proves money can't buy everything.
